Kempf. 9 10 #ifndef BOOST_THREAD_RS06040501_HPP 11 #define BOOST_THREAD_RS06040501_HPP 12 13 // fetch compiler and platform configuration 14 #include <boost/config.hpp> 15 16 // insist on threading support being available: 17 #include <boost/config/requires_threads.hpp> 18 19 // choose platform 20 #if defined(linux) || defined(__linux) || defined(__linux__) 21 # define BOOST_THREAD_LINUX 22 //# define BOOST_THREAD_WAIT_BUG boost::posix_time::microseconds(100000) 23 #elif defined(__FreeBSD__) || defined(__NetBSD__) || defined(__OpenBSD__) || defined(__DragonFly__) 24 # define BOOST_THREAD_BSD 25 #elif defined(sun) || defined(__sun) 26 # define BOOST_THREAD_SOLARIS 27 #elif defined(__sgi) 28 # define BOOST_THREAD_IRIX 29 #elif defined(__hpux) 30 # define BOOST_THREAD_HPUX 31 #elif defined(__CYGWIN__) 32 # define BOOST_THREAD_CYGWIN 33 #elif (defined(_WIN32) || defined(__WIN32__) || defined(WIN32)) && !defined(BOOST_DISABLE_WIN32) 34 #if ! defined BOOST_THREAD_WIN32 35 # define BOOST_THREAD_WIN32 36 #endif 37 #elif defined(__BEOS__) 38 # define BOOST_THREAD_BEOS 39 #elif defined(macintosh) || defined(__APPLE__) || defined(__APPLE_CC__) 40 # define BOOST_THREAD_MACOS 41 //# define BOOST_THREAD_WAIT_BUG boost::posix_time::microseconds(1000) 42 #elif defined(__IBMCPP__) || defined(_AIX) 43 # define BOOST_THREAD_AIX 44 #elif defined(__amigaos__) 45 # define BOOST_THREAD_AMIGAOS 46 #elif defined(__QNXNTO__) 47 # define BOOST_THREAD_QNXNTO 48 #elif defined(unix) || defined(__unix) || defined(_XOPEN_SOURCE) || defined(_POSIX_SOURCE) 49 # if defined(BOOST_HAS_PTHREADS) && !defined(BOOST_THREAD_POSIX) 50 # define BOOST_THREAD_POSIX 51 # endif 52 #endif 53 54 // For every supported platform add a new entry into the dispatch table below. 55 // BOOST_THREAD_POSIX is tested first, so on platforms where posix and native 56 // threading is available, the user may choose, by defining BOOST_THREAD_POSIX 57 // in her source. If a platform is known to support pthreads and no native 58 // port of boost_thread is available just specify "pthread" in the 59 // dispatcher table. If there is no entry for a platform but pthreads is 60 // available on the platform, pthread is choosen as default. If nothing is 61 // available the preprocessor will fail with a diagnostic message. 62 63 #if defined(BOOST_THREAD_POSIX) 64 # define BOOST_THREAD_PLATFORM_PTHREAD 65 #else 66 # if defined(BOOST_THREAD_WIN32) 67 # define BOOST_THREAD_PLATFORM_WIN32 68 # elif defined(BOOST_HAS_PTHREADS) 69 # define BOOST_THREAD_PLATFORM_PTHREAD 70 # else 71 # error "Sorry, no boost threads are available for this platform." 72 # endif 73 #endif 74 75 #endif // BOOST_THREAD_RS06040501_HPP 76
